In these Barramundi and Bluewater Safaris we fish the saltwater tidal streams of the Finnis River catching the tremendous fighting, lure spitting, tail wagging Saltwater Barra.

Plus spend a couple of days targeting a large variety of hard fighting bluewater reef fish which include the famous Jewfish, Snapper, Coral Trout, Red Emperor and the pelagic fish species such as Tuna, Mackerel, Queenfish and the Giant Trevally. Here we fish the great coastlines of Dundee Beach and Bynoe Harbour, their external Islands and Reefs, and the famous  Peron Islands.

Typical Itinerary of a 5 Day Barra to Sailfish/Pelagics Bluewater Safari are:

  • Fly in Day 2011

    Depart Home state flights arranged by self (times TBA). Arrive Darwin and transfer to Darwin’s Barra Base B & B. Courtesy Bus pick up from airport free if arrive before 7.30pm, if after get a taxi to 2 Todd Cres Malak. Our rates include first night accommodation at Darwins Barra Base for repeat business groups and new groups of 4 or more, otherwise it's at normal room rates.

  • 1st Day 2011

    Travel early (5am) to accommodation and drop off bags. Pick up lunches and travel on to Dundee and complete full day Barra fishing chasing the almighty saltwater Barra, or bluewater and pelagic fishing depending on the tides and wind. Returning back to Dundee ramp approx 6pm clean & park boat and travel to accommodation for rest, evening meal & overnight accommodation.

  • 2nd- 4th Day 2011
  • Up 5.30am early breakfast at 6am, travel to boat park prepare and launch boats at Dundee ramp and travel to the right spot to do Barra fishing, or chasing and pulling up the freight trains of the sea those metre-plus Black Jewfish, or pulling up 7-8Kg Golden Snappers. Most just smile their heads off whilst holding up 30lb, 40lb, or 50lb plus Pelagic, like Spanish Mackerel, Queenfish and Long Tail Tuna. Depending on the tidal influence we normally return back to Boat Ramp approx 5 - 5.30pm. Return boat to private boat park, clean and prepare boat for next day. Travel back to accommodation. Down a couple of coldies at the bar, shower, rest up or go for a swim. Take in the evening meal, have a few drinks & sleep

  • 5th Day 2011

    Up 5.30am early breakfast and out fishing, returning back to Dundee ramp approx 3pm. Clean & pack up boat and drive back to Darwin’s Barra Base. Rest, drink & prepare for evening meal where awards for fishing excellence will be handed out. Sleep at Darwin’s Barra Base B & B, and or catch the midnight flight home (flights arranged by self). Pack up frozen fish caught in approved flight boxes for air transport and gain taxi to airport.

  • 6th Day or Stay on @ B&B

    Depart Darwin flights arranged by self (times TBA). Pack up fish in fish approved transport boxes for flight home. Free transfer to Airport if during daylight hours. Or stay on at Darwin’s Barra Base B&B and sightsee Darwin & tropical NT. Please book all extra accommodation if you are intending on staying on after the Safari.
